Description
Caravan manufacturer Willerby Holiday Homes has announced plans to cut 193 jobs in Hull. The company blamed the ongoing 'economic uncertainty' and therefore the need to ensure the sustainability of the business.
The announcement comes after the introduction of a 5% caravan tax by the government earlier this year. The company will implement the redundancies over a six-month period starting in September.
